What is Musely Translate Label Photo?

Musely Translate Label Photo is an AI-powered tool that translates text on product labels in real-world photographs—including food packaging, cosmetic bottles, supplement containers, and household products—across 136 languages while preserving the physical packaging appearance, photographic perspective, and label design. Unlike OCR-overlay tools that add flat text over product photos, Musely regenerates the photo with translated text naturally rendered on curved and angled label surfaces. The AI handles ingredient lists, nutrition facts, safety warnings, and all label copy. Musely achieves 99.1% visual accuracy per processed label photo.

Google Translate Lens overlays flat translated text on top of product photos, which looks unnatural on curved bottle labels and often obscures brand logos and safety symbols. Musely regenerates the label photo with translated text appearing naturally on the product surface—accounting for photographic perspective, label curvature, and real-world lighting. The result looks like a photo of a naturally printed translated label.

Musely handles label photos of curved packaging—bottles, jars, cans, tubes, and rounded containers—by detecting text on curved label surfaces and rendering translated text with natural curvature and perspective. The AI accounts for the photographic angle and label surface geometry to produce translated label photos that look naturally printed rather than digitally overlaid.

Musely handles label photos from food and beverage packaging, cosmetic and beauty bottles, dietary supplement containers, cleaning and household products, pharmaceutical packaging, and any other physical product with printed labels. Supported photo formats include JPG, PNG, WebP, BMP, and TIFF up to 20MB. The tool processes 136 target languages.

Musely uses AI-native image regeneration to detect text regions on label photos—including text that follows the curve of a bottle or the taper of a label—and renders translated text with the same natural curvature, perspective, and visual integration as the original. This differs from standard OCR overlay tools, which add flat text layers that look artificially pasted over the product image.
